A new study has warned that a third of all men currently under the age of 20 in China will eventually die prematurely if they do not give up smoking.

The research, published in The Lancet medical journal, says two-thirds of men in China now start to smoke before 20, and concludes that around half of those men will die from the habit.

According to BBC News, the scientists conducted two nationwide studies, 15 years apart, covering hundreds of thousands of people.
